The following phenomena is called dispersion through water and dispersion through the prism .

A light ray is refracted (bent) when it passes from one medium to another at an angle and its speed changes. At the interface, it is bent in one direction if the material it enters is denser (when light slows down) and in the other direction if the material is less dense (when light speeds up). Because different wavelengths (colours) of light travel through a medium at different speeds, the amount of bending is different for different wavelengths. Violet is bent the most and red the least because violet light has a shorter wavelength, and short wavelengths travel more slowly through a medium than longer ones do. Because white light is made up of all visible wavelengths, its colours can be separated (dispersed) by this difference in behaviour. 
When light travels from one medium to another, it bends. In other words, it changes direction and moves at different speeds in different mediums. This property of light is called “refraction”.
We also know that white light is made up of different colours. Different colours of light have different frequencies. Except in vacuum and air, they travel at different speeds in different mediums.
If you were to allow a beam of light to pass through a simple prism, it will bend when it enters the prism, when it leaves the prism it bends again. The different colours of the white light travel with different speeds inside the prism. The slanted surfaces of the prism makes the different colours emerge separately, thus in addition to bending light as a whole, a prism separates white light into its component colours. This splitting of light into its component colours is called dispersion, where prism is a dispersing element.
This is exactly what happens when the sun rays hit droplets of water. When the sunlight strikes a raindrop, the light is refracted (bent) because the light is moving from one medium(air) to another( water). Drops of rainwater can disperse light in the same way as a prism.. When the light comes out of the water droplet, the sun's rays (white light)have now been split into their component wavelengths (colours). In this way, each individual raindrop behaves just like a prism, dispersing white sunlight into its seven component colours and a rainbow is formed.
The rainbow we see is thus a result of many, many raindrops bending the sun's rays.
